    74HC4040N,652 Frequently Asked Questions (FAQs)

    • The maximum clock frequency for the 74HC4040N is 25 MHz, but it can be operated at higher frequencies with reduced supply voltage and/or lower temperatures.
    • To ensure proper power and decoupling, use a 0.1 μF ceramic capacitor between VCC and GND, and a 10 μF electrolytic capacitor between VCC and GND, with a maximum distance of 10 mm from the device.
    • The recommended operating temperature range for the 74HC4040N is -40°C to +125°C, but it can be operated at temperatures up to 150°C with reduced reliability.
    • During power-up, the asynchronous reset input (MR) should be held low for at least 10 ns to ensure that the device is properly reset. After power-up, MR can be released to allow normal operation.
    • The maximum output current that can be sourced or sunk by the 74HC4040N is 25 mA per output pin, with a total current limit of 100 mA for all output pins combined.
